Experimental study on preparation of nanometer magnesium oxide by liquid-phase method

The system of this article introduces the nature of nano -magnesium oxide, and the current status of research at home and abroad has conducted an in -depth analysis of the process of preparing the process of nano -magnesium oxide.On this basis, combined with the results of small test experiments, the central tornado flow was designed for nano -magnesium magnesium -to -magnesium research experimental solutions.

Through experimental analysis of various influencing factors, the best process conditions for nano -magnesium oxide are optimized.Finally, through the modification of nano -magnesium oxide, the high decentralized and stable magnesium oxide modified powder after combining the compound key was obtained.the result shows:

1. When using sodium carbonate, magnesium chloride as the raw material, use a liquid phase method. When the central tornado stirrer amplifies magnesium oxide, the central tornado stirrer can meet the system heat transfer requirements. The temperature concentration is evenly distributed, so that the front body of the generated magnesium carbonate is completely and uniformly suspended in the reactor.

2. In the process of liquid reaction, adding sulfonol as a dispersant can well inhibit the growth of magnesium carbonate, and effectively disperse magnesium carbonate precipitation generated.

3. The central tornado stirrer prepares magnesium oxide. The best process conditions are: the reaction temperature is 30 ° C, the reaction time is 30min, the stirring speed is 350R/min; the concentration of magnesium chloride solution is 2mol/L, and the concentration of sodium carbonate solution is 2.5 mol/L; Disted sulfurnol adds 9.6ml; 煅 Boil conditions are: 90min at 500 ° C. Under this condition, a magnesium oxide powder with a uniform distribution of granularity is 14nm.

4. Magnetic oxide oxide can cause magnesium oxide surfaces to combine chemical bonds with AOT, so as to obtain nano -magnesium magnesium oxide particles with good decentralization, more stable, and more uniform granularity. The best conditions for modification are: modified temperature 40 ° C, and the modification time is 45 minutes.
